Remove pay anomalies: GEWJAC

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, May 3: J&K Govt Employees & Workers Joint Action Committee has urged upon the State Government to remove pay anomalies of the clerical cadre, release 6% DA of the employees and increase medical allowance from Rs 300 to Rs 2000 per month in favour of State employees and pensioners.
In a meeting of the Joint Action Committee held here today under the chairmanship of trade union leader, Babu Hussain Malik, the members urged upon then State Chief Minister and the Chief Secretary to direct the newly framed Pay Anomaly Committee to submit report within 15 days and implement the same before the adoption of 7th Pay Commission report. They further demanded regularization of daily rated/ contractual workers.
They also appealed the Govt to implement the High Court orders with regard to removal of pay anomalies in letter and spirit.
